What is Prosperity Point and How to Access It?
Prosperity Point is a temporary premium land that operates on a monthly subscription basis. This location is exclusively available for players on the Portal version of the game. You can access it via the hot air balloon located right in the center of your city. Once your subscription is active, you can travel there and start building right away!

Why You'll Love It
This isn't just "more land"—it’s a stress-free zone for your biggest architectural projects. All expansions here are completely free, and there are no obstacles to clear. You spend your time creating, not cleaning. The total size of Prosperity Point is 5x5 expansions, with each individual expansion giving you a generous 12x12 grid to build on. It's not just a decor zone! Anything you collect from buildings placed here still counts toward your overall game progress.
Need to clear your space quickly or save your setup before a subscription pause? You can easily send all your buildings back to your inventory with just a single button click!

Important Limitations to Keep in Mind
To help you plan your city efficiently, please note the following technical rules for this location:
- Expansion Quests: Purchasing expansions in Prosperity Point does not count toward in-game tasks that ask you to "buy/get expansions". To complete those quests, you must purchase expansions in other standard game locations.
- Placement Restrictions: You cannot place the Wind Rose here. Additionally, buildings or decorations that require water or have strict location restrictions cannot be placed in Prosperity Point.
- No City Traffic: Buildings and decor placed here will not generate moving cars.
Managing Your Subscription
You are always in control of your monthly subscription (which is auto-renewable by default), and you can cancel it at any moment.

If your subscription ends, you will lose access to Prosperity Point. If you have buildings placed there when the subscription ends, you will be able to send them back to your storage, but their uncollected profit will be lost.
